Is Antigua affordable?

December 14, 2021 by Trevor Zboncak

Antigua has long been synonymous with tucked-away upscale resorts like Jumby Bay and the newer Hermitage Bay, where rates can run $500 to $1,000 a night.

Contents

Is Antigua expensive to travel to?

The average price of a 7-day trip to Antigua is $1,167 for a solo traveler, $2,096 for a couple, and $3,929 for a family of 4. Antigua hotels range from $44 to $200 per night with an average of $77, while most vacation rentals will cost $140 to $420 per night for the entire home.

Is food and drink expensive in Antigua?

In terms of food and drink prices, it will work out as approximately the same as in the UK – all food is imported, so is slightly more expensive (other than staples like rice, bread, pasta etc), but drinks are generally quite a lot cheaper, both in the supermarket and when out and about.

Is it cheap to eat out in Antigua?

It’s obviously possible to eat for a lot less…. though maybe not with wine which tends to be pricey. In particular, there are a lot of mid-priced and inexpensive places in the English Harbour area, and lots of various local places, casual beach bars, and pizza places scattered about the island.

Is it worth going to Antigua?

It’s got beautiful beaches, it’s got great resorts, it’s got an interesting weekly market, it’s got some outstanding scenic views, it’s got a lot of interesting adventure activities, the travel infrastructure is pretty good, and the island is large enough to have variety but small enough to get around in one day.

How much money do you need to live in Antigua?

You can live on Antigua for as little as US$800/month or spend US4,000+. But, I would say to live comfortably and not completly rough it, you would need US$1,500-2,000/month.

Are groceries expensive in Antigua?

Food prices in supermarkets are higher than in United States. For example, in Antigua and Barbuda you have to pay for: Bottle or carton of milk (1 liter): 1.90 USD (5.00 XCD)A bottle of beer from a known brand: 2.70 USD (7.30 XCD)

Are credit cards accepted in Antigua?

Major credit cards including American Express, Diners Club, MasterCard and Visa are accepted all over the islands.

Is Antigua safe to walk around?

While the island nation of Antigua and Barbuda is generally safe, petty crime can still challenge travelers – even the most experienced.You may have read about violent robbery and murder on the main island Antigua, but attacks on tourists are extremely rare.

Which is better Barbados or Antigua?

Both have stunning beaches, but Antigua – as the slightly less touristy of the two islands – tends to have more isolated and secluded choices. It arguably has better beaches than Barbados too. However the infrastructure in Barbados is some of the best in the Caribbean, and it’s a very easy island to get around.

Can you use American money in Antigua?

Money. The currency of Antigua and Barbuda is the Eastern Caribbean dollar (EC$ or XCD).US dollars are widely accepted on the island, though you will usually be given change in EC dollars, and at a less favorable exchange rate.
